Originally Posted by Golfingdad

Interesting ... Erik mentioned a round grip on his Edel as well.  Did you get fitted for the grip, or is that based solely on preference?  I have an old Ping putter with the standard ping grip, and its falling apart, so I now get to consider all other options.  Golfsmith sells the Ping grip so I could very easily replace it with that one, or the ever popular fat grips, and now you and Erik have added round grips to my choices as well. :)

Round grips are kind of Edel's thing.... with a normal putter grip, if it moves at all or is put on improperly it can mess with your aim... this isn't the case with a round grip since it's the same all the way around. Also, with the round grips, I was told that it help to keep even pressure.
